[BACK]Return to patch.c CVS log [TXT][DIR] Up to [local] / src / usr.bin / patch

Diff for /src/usr.bin/patch/patch.c between version 1.16 and 1.17

version 1.16, 2003/04/05 17:17:53 version 1.17, 2003/07/02 00:21:16
Line 102 
Line 102 
         tmpdir = "/tmp";          tmpdir = "/tmp";
       }        }
   
       if (asprintf(&TMPOUTNAME, "%s/patchoXXXXXX", tmpdir) == -1)        if (asprintf(&TMPOUTNAME, "%s/patchoXXXXXXXXXX", tmpdir) == -1)
         fatal1("cannot allocate memory");          fatal1("cannot allocate memory");
       if ((i = mkstemp(TMPOUTNAME)) < 0)        if ((i = mkstemp(TMPOUTNAME)) < 0)
         pfatal2("can't create %s", TMPOUTNAME);          pfatal2("can't create %s", TMPOUTNAME);
       Close(i);        Close(i);
   
       if (asprintf(&TMPINNAME, "%s/patchiXXXXXX", tmpdir) == -1)        if (asprintf(&TMPINNAME, "%s/patchiXXXXXXXXXX", tmpdir) == -1)
         fatal1("cannot allocate memory");          fatal1("cannot allocate memory");
       if ((i = mkstemp(TMPINNAME)) < 0)        if ((i = mkstemp(TMPINNAME)) < 0)
         pfatal2("can't create %s", TMPINNAME);          pfatal2("can't create %s", TMPINNAME);
       Close(i);        Close(i);
   
       if (asprintf(&TMPREJNAME, "%s/patchrXXXXXX", tmpdir) == -1)        if (asprintf(&TMPREJNAME, "%s/patchrXXXXXXXXXX", tmpdir) == -1)
         fatal1("cannot allocate memory");          fatal1("cannot allocate memory");
       if ((i = mkstemp(TMPREJNAME)) < 0)        if ((i = mkstemp(TMPREJNAME)) < 0)
         pfatal2("can't create %s", TMPREJNAME);          pfatal2("can't create %s", TMPREJNAME);
       Close(i);        Close(i);
   
       if (asprintf(&TMPPATNAME, "%s/patchpXXXXXX", tmpdir) == -1)        if (asprintf(&TMPPATNAME, "%s/patchpXXXXXXXXXX", tmpdir) == -1)
         fatal1("cannot allocate memory");          fatal1("cannot allocate memory");
       if ((i = mkstemp(TMPPATNAME)) < 0)        if ((i = mkstemp(TMPPATNAME)) < 0)
         pfatal2("can't create %s", TMPPATNAME);          pfatal2("can't create %s", TMPPATNAME);

Legend:
Removed from v.1.16  
changed lines
  Added in v.1.17